Building Equitable Cities with Henry Cisneros: How to Drive Economic Mobility and Regional Growth – ULI Indiana

An increasingly common concern in cities across the US is that the overall urban revival is leaving growing numbers of residents behind. In addition, evidence suggests that more “equitable” cities are stronger economically. So how can real estate and land use leaders work together to create more inclusive urban prosperity? This is the subject of a recent ULI publication: Building Equitable Cities: How to Drive Economic Mobility and Regional Growth, co-authored by Henry Cisneros, chairman of CityView in San Antonio, Texas.

Join ULI Indiana on September 5 and hear from Cisneros, past Mayor of San Antonio and former Secretary of the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development, as he discusses the issue. At this special ULI Indiana program, Cisneros will describe the business and social case for real estate and land use leaders to help create a more inclusive urban prosperity, detailing what’s working and how to do more of it in areas of wide interest.
